Why Safety Matters on OLX

When using OLX to sell, you're engaging in transactions with potentially unknown buyers. This inherently introduces risk. The safety of OLX involves several factors:

1. Platform Security Measures: OLX employs various security protocols to protect users. This includes monitoring transactions, flagging suspicious activity, and implementing safety tips for users. However, the effectiveness of these measures depends on your awareness and vigilance.

2. User Verification: OLX allows users to report suspicious behavior and offers a system to verify the identities of buyers and sellers. Despite these features, the platform doesn’t guarantee complete protection, making user diligence crucial.

3. Payment Methods: OLX doesn’t handle transactions directly; instead, it facilitates the connection between buyers and sellers. This means you're responsible for ensuring safe payment methods and protecting your financial information.

4. Personal Safety Tips: Always meet in public places, avoid sharing personal information, and trust your instincts. Safety is not just about the platform but also about how you manage interactions with potential buyers.

Tips for Enhancing Safety on OLX

1. Verify Buyer’s Information: Before finalizing a sale, ensure that the buyer has a verified profile and read their reviews if available.

2. Use Secure Payment Methods: Prefer cash transactions or verified payment systems to avoid financial scams.

3. Meet in Safe Locations: Opt for public and secure locations for in-person transactions. Avoid meeting at private or secluded places.

4. Report Suspicious Activity: Use OLX’s reporting features to alert the platform of any unusual or suspicious behavior.
